Serious Dodge Model Missing crash on the A945 - 30 Oct 1992

Accident reference 1992929207051

Serious Accident

Accident summary

On Friday 30 October 1992 at 13:30 a serious collision occurred near A945 involving 2 vehicles (dodge model missing) and 1 casualty (1 serious) Weather at the time was recorded as fine no high winds. Road surface conditions were wet or damp. Lighting was described as daylight.

Key details

  • Posted speed limit: 30 mph
  • Road type: Single carriageway
  • Junction: Private drive or entrance
